POSITION ANNOUNCEMENTPOSITION: PSM Coordinator
DEPARTMENT: Maintenance
LOCATION: Ottumwa
SALARY CLASS: Exempt
Objective: To organize and maintain the Process Safety Management (PSM) program for Pilgrims ammonia refrigeration systems. Has ownership of all aspects of the PSM/RMP process and will work closely with all site personnel and leadership, to ensure site compliance with OSHA and EPA requirements as well as adherence to all company and site policies and procedures.
Basic Skills- Math
- Effective communication
- Reading and comprehension
- able to learn APSM web based management program
- able to work in Excel, Word, and Power Point
- able to learn SAP CMMS (beneficial)
- AutoCAD (beneficial)
- File organization – able to manage records accurately
- Maintain Bulletin Board PSM information
- Manage flow of PSM documentation between - Refrigeration management/Operators/Corporate PSM Manager/Upper Management
- Set up Monthly PSM meetings with Refrigeration Management and operators/technicians
- Maintain APSM data ensuring that all information is up to date, and that all folders and information contained therein have current information pertaining to all PSM program elements and subsequent action items and records.
- Manage all file system records for applicable program elements, i.e., PM records, B-109 records, MOC records, Incident Investigation records, Employee Participation records, Training records, and all other such records generated from any PSM/RMP program elements.
- Maintain Bulletin Boards with current PSM/refrigeration information, applicable incident reports, and other relevant PSM/refrigeration department information.
- Schedule and participate in monthly refrigeration department PSM meetings – review all open action items, status of B-109 inspections, SOP refresher training, and other pertinent items, like MOC project updates and incident reports.
- Participate in corporate facilitated PSM Information conference call – prepare to deliver one such meeting with support from corporate PSM manager.
- Prepare the quarterly status report by updating all open recommendation tracking sheets with the refrigeration management. Schedule and participate in Quarterly PSM Review meeting.
- Participate in 3-year Compliance Audits and 5-year Process Hazard Analysis, and maintain open recommendation tracking forms.
- Work with 3rd party and Corporate PSM Manager to coordinate and complete the 5-year Mechanical Integrity Inspection. Maintain open recommendation tracking forms.
- Participate in all government inspections including: OSHA’s NEP, PQV, and EMP’s RMP inspections. Assist with the gathering of all requested records, and program guidelines for associated PSM/RMP elements.
- Have been trained in the following within 1st year of hire:
- PSM/RMP course (outside company)
- Hazmat certified (8 hour minimum)
- APSM
- Incident Command system certified (optional)
SAP - AutoCAD (optional)
- Ensure hourly employees are involved with the development and review of Process Safety Information
- Ensure hourly employees are involved during the PHA and CA processes
- Maintain PSM team meeting minutes and post (at least monthly)
- Work with Safety Management to develop/provide information for annual PSM training of all site personnel
- Maintain up to date PSM related activities on the maintenance bulletin boards
- Utilize PAC-14 or develop other training to review on a monthly basis with all refrigeration operators/technicians.
- Ensure refrigeration staff review P&’s annually, and review all valves for accurate valve tags and maintain documentation in APSM
- Ensure refrigeration staff cycle ammonia valves annually
- Ensure B-109 inspections are completed annually for each piece of equipment and maintain documentation in APSM
- (Use the Annual Revalidation Sheet for the above) (assemble PM’s and file once closed)
- Update the inventory calculations, equipment list, and valve list for site with assistance from refrigeration supervisor and maintain documentation in APSM
